Product description

What it is and why people buy it

This Suyeah 49.21ft drip irrigation kit is aimed at turning a basic garden watering setup into something more targeted and “set-and-forget”. On paper, it’s a misting/drip-style garden irrigation system that can split the water flow into multiple outlets (the base description mentions up to 15 branches). The idea is to reduce waste versus traditional watering, and it also claims to help with weaker pressure towards the end of a longer run.

A practical way to think about it: if you have a stretch of plants where you keep forgetting to water evenly (or where water tends to run off rather than soak in), a drip/mist layout can make that more consistent. It’s not the same as a full irrigation controller system, but for many small to medium garden jobs it’s a workable step up.

Installation and everyday use tips

Setup is positioned as flexible rather than complicated. The description says you can cut the irrigation tube to length, then use the quick connector for a Plug and Play connection. In practical terms, a good first step is to plan your routes and mark where you want mist/drip to land before cutting anything—especially if you’re aiming the bendable nozzle to different plant heights.

For example, imagine a small greenhouse bench with seedlings at the front and taller pots behind. You could bend the nozzle so it points forward for the front row, then adjust the angle for a different segment so the spray/mist doesn’t just bounce off the pot rims. If you’re mounting parts near a fence, the description also mentions fixation options and that you may be able to hang the kit without fixed stakes, which can be handy for temporary layouts.

Compatibility and requirements to check before buying

One limitation is clearly spelled out: the adaptor for the tap is suitable for 3/4 inch male threaded taps. Before ordering, it’s worth checking what tap connector you have. If your outdoor tap doesn’t match that thread size, you may need a different adaptor to make the system work.

Also, because this kit is presented as “automatic drip irrigation”, it still relies on your water supply being capable of providing adequate pressure and flow. If your setup struggles for pressure already, the description claims this system can help at the far end—but in real gardens, results can vary.
